Find the value of x, y, and z in the rhombus below. The number is 108. The blanks are -2y+4, 3z+9, and -x+1.

In a rhombus opposite angles are equal and adjacent angles are supplementary. So the angle opposite 108 is also 108, and the two remaining angles are 180 − 108 = 72.
If 3z + 9 is the angle opposite 108, and −2y + 4 and −x + 1 are the two adjacent angles, then
3z + 9 = 108 => 3z = 99 => z = 33,
−2y + 4 = 72 => −2y = 68 => y = −34,
−x + 1 = 72 => −x = 71 => x = −71.
